Research And Design Of Engine Cylinder Head Bolt Fastening Robot Arm Based On Parallel Mechanism

The assembly of threaded coupling group plays an important role in modern automobile production line. Therefore, it needs a technologically advanced, flexible, intelligent assembly system of threaded coupling. The system can be used to complete high-precision threaded coupling automated assembly of automobile or parts. This article takes the assembly of engine cylinder head bolt for example, aims to develop a low cost, small size, flexible fastening robot arm.The fastening robot arm designed in this paper includes terminal tightening shaft portion, parallel mechanism assembly, ball splines assembly and power unit assembly. This research project belongs to the field of industrial robot arm, relying on a parallel mechanism to achieve single tighten axis’ s fast-moving, to achieve tighten device’s simplified design. The application of parallel mechanism is the key to tighten the robotic arm, so the research and design of parallel mechanism assembly is the focus of this article. The use of ball splines optimized system structure in the design process of fastening robot arm. After the design is complete, this article does simulation and design optimization about fastening robot arm by CATIA. This article took advantage of virtual assembly technology to select and design related components, carried out virtual assembly analysis and simulation based on 3D models. The fastening robot arm was tested to change the existing interference or error. The main moving parts were simulated by finite element, analysised stress, provided the basis for modification in the future.In the study of the design process, this article provides an example of a device developed from the perspective of virtual technology’s design methods and theory. The results show that this design theory can meet the needs of equipment design, improves the design efficiency and reduces the costs ofdevelopment.
